2. The Illusion of Control

Many bettors operate under the illusion that they can control outcomes, particularly in sports betting. This belief can stem from a bettor’s familiarity with a particular sport or team. While knowledge can improve betting strategies, it does not guarantee success. The unpredictability of sports can lead to overconfidence and ultimately, poor decision-making.

3. Loss Aversion

Loss aversion, a key concept in behavioral economics, explains why bettors often feel the pain of a loss more acutely than the pleasure of a win. This can lead to a cycle of chasing losses, where bettors place increasingly risky bets in an attempt to recover their previous losses. This behavior can quickly spiral out of control.

4. Social Influences and Groupthink

Betting often has a social component, whether it’s placing bets with friends or following betting trends. Social influences can lead to groupthink, where individuals go along with the majority opinion rather than making independent decisions. This can lead to poor betting choices based on social pressure rather than solid reasoning.
